Requirement   /rɪkwˈaɪrmənt/   Listen
Requirement

noun
1.
Required activity.  Synonym: demand.  "There were many demands on his time"
2.
Anything indispensable.  Synonyms: essential, necessary, necessity, requisite.  "The essentials of the good life" , "Allow farmers to buy their requirements under favorable conditions" , "A place where the requisites of water fuel and fodder can be obtained"  Antonym: inessential.
3.
Something that is required in advance.  Synonym: prerequisite.
